Efficiency of a multiple stage crushing plant can be maximized by operating a primary crusher at a setting which produces a satisfactory feed size for the secondary crusher and operating the secondary crusher (or the last stage crusher) in a closed circuit.
A well-designed plant layout balances the capital versus operating cost over mine life. Buildings, infrastructure, and major equipment items, represent the major cost elements of a crushing plant. Sintering is a process of agglomeration of fine mineral particles into a porous and lumpy mass by incipient fusion caused by heat produced by combustion of solid fuel within the mass itself. As the mechanism of crushing in these crushers are similar to gyratory crushers their designs are similar, but in this case the spindle is supported at the bottom of the gyrating cone instead of being suspended as in larger gyratory crushers. Fig. 5.3 is a schematic diagram of a cone crusher.

Aggregate production plants use screens to direct, separate, and control material flow in the process. The two main purposes for screening the aggregates are to remove oversize material from the crusher product or undersize material from the crushing plant and to completely size the materials produced.

In the diagram, the broken line through the centre of the crushing chamber is the line-of-mean-diameters of the compacted areas. When the profiles of both crushing fact's are straight lines, as in the case under consideration, this mean-diameter line is also straight, and its slope depends upon the relative tapers of the head and concaves.
